Play on Words Festival 
22 - 28 October 2026 

                                                       SAVE THE DATES

Thanks to ongoing support from the National Lottery through Arts Council England, Culture in Common, New Forest District Council and other partners, Play on Words returns this autumn from 22-28 October bringing together writers, readers and lovers of words for a lively festival programme for all ages in the New Forest.

Ahead of a full programme announcement, there are a couple of ways for local people to get involved.

The Local Writer Showcase at St Barbe in Lymington takes place on 24th October from 7pm - 9.30pm. This event offers the chance for writers from the New Forest and surrounding areas to meet others locally and to discuss, share and sell their work.

We're particularly interested in hearing stories and experiences related to festival themes around the power of what people can achieve by coming together, but writers working in any form or genre are welcome.

 Grant Funding - Residencies - Commissions  

Opportunities are available for individual artists and creatives looking for support for developing their work and experimenting with new ideas.

Hampshire Cultural Trust's Creative Ground Open Commissions are specifically for artists making work that clearly connects to place in New Forest, Gosport and Rushmoor, with up to £3,000 available per artist. Applications close on the 18 July: for more information click here.

The Hugo Burge Foundation is inviting applications for the Creative Individuals grant which can go towards multiple stages of a project including research and development, testing, and delivery. This year's fund closes on the 31 July and more information can be found here.
